Özet (EN)
Women have assumed many roles in the historical process from the existence of humanity to the present day. As of the century we live in, changes in social and cultural fields, developments in economy and technology in the world and in Turkey have increased the ratio of women in working life and enabled women to take on new role models. One of these new role models is entrepreneurship. As in most countries of the world, various programs, projects and studies are carried out through many national and international organizations in order to support women's entrepreneurship in our country. Thanks to the developments in the socio-economic level throughout the country and the projects that support women's entrepreneurship, the number of women entrepreneurs is increasing throughout the country, although not at the desired rate. By the way, women can be seen in the international arena, albeit to a limited extent, but their number in this area is quite low compared to their local visibility. The question asked in this research is: Why is the number of women entrepreneurs low when it comes to international entrepreneurship? What are the obstacles that women entrepreneurs face when entering the international arena? Purpose of the research; The aim is to reveal the obstacles and opportunities that Turkish women entrepreneurs face towards becoming international entrepreneurs. In order to achieve this aim, the phenomenon was tried to be explained by using the phenomenology (phenomenology) pattern, one of the qualitative research techniques. The data were collected through interviews with the help of a semi-structured interview form developed by the researcher. In the interviews, women belonging to various professions, living in Malatya, and entrepreneurs at certain periods of their lives were interviewed. The obtained data were analyzed with the help of maxquda program. As a result of these analyzes, while the biggest obstacle to being a female entrepreneur in the local area is gender discrimination, the excess of legal processes and procedures, language problem, and lack of information are seen as the first obstacles in the international arena.
